spatial data with binomial distribution
Dear Daniela, You could first generate a grid with the mean proportion on the logit scale. You can use grf() to do that since the mean in the logit scale is linear like the normal distribution. In step 2 you backtransform from the logit scale to the original scale. E.g. with plogis(). Step 3 generates binomial values based on the proportions from step 2. E.g. with rbinom(). Hello,I'm trying to simulate a grid with binomial distribution spacially
dependent. For the normal distribution, the package geoR has the command
grf(). Has anyone some ideia how can I do this?Thanks a lot, Daniela.
